Lewiston students graduate from Tufts University
MEDFORD, Mass. — Two Lewiston students graduated May 22 from Tufts University during a university-wide commencement ceremony. The graduates from the School of Arts and Sciences and the School of Engineering included Brooke Smiley and Jordan Smiley, who both graduated summa cum laude with Bachelor of Science degree in Biomedical Engineering.
